Shutterstock/ katiemariephotography Located simply beyond the Portland city restrictions, the Columbia River Chasm offers a few of one of the most excellent views in the area. There are additionally loads of hiking and biking chances to utilize on, together with 90 different waterfalls to explore. The gorge really did not make it onto the map up until the early 1800s, after Lewis and Clark made their exploration into the area, though it had been populated long prior to their arrival.

Shutterstock/ Sean Attilio Learn Situated in Northeast Rose City, the Grotto consists of 62 acres of rich yards. The attraction, which was integrated in 1924 as an outdoor Roman Catholic refuge dedicated to Mary, Our Woman of Sorrows, is meant for individuals of all faiths that remain in search of petition and reflection.


There's also a close-by trail lined with moss trees and elaborately carved sculptures representing the 14 Terminals of the Cross. Throughout the years, the National Shelter has drawn in over ten million visitors. Shutterstock/ ARTYOORAN Established back in 1892, the Portland Art Museum is the oldest of its kind in the Pacific Northwest.




Collections are housed in both traditionally preserved and freshly designed building spaces. There is art from different cultures, digital photography shows, and much more modern-day demonstrations. Educational tours are additionally used throughout news the year. Other events consist of musician talks, seminars, and family-friendly programs.
